Health Long COVID may be due to the virus sticking around after infection, researchers say Jackson's new book, Clearing the Fog, is a practical guide for long COVID patients and their families, giving advice on how to find help, and information on treatments and strategies for dealing with symptoms. "Many people with mild cases are profoundly debilitated, and some people with quite severe cases are doing fairly well." "This is a little bit of a mystery," Jackson says. Jackson, who is a research professor at Vanderbilt University, says that while long COVID was initially associated with people who became critically ill with COVID-19, he's seeing an increasing number of patients for whom the initial illness was relatively mild. These symptoms can lead to a loss of employment, income and important relationships. Some of the most troubling symptoms are neurological: struggling to remember things, to focus, even to perform basic daily tasks and solve problems. Jackson says people with long COVID can suffer from symptoms like exhaustion, shortness of breath and disturbed sleep. As the Biden administration ends the COVID-19 public health emergency, millions of Americans who contracted the disease continue to suffer from symptoms associated with long COVID.
